This post, two days after the FBI's Mar-a-Lago search warrant was unsealed revealing classified document recovery, demonstrates a textbook narcissistic injury response through supply-seeking rather than rage. Trump bypasses the substance of the investigation entirely, instead citing poll numbers and donations as proxy evidence of innocence—a logical fallacy (argumentum ad populum) elevated to defense strategy. The framing of a lawful federal investigation as a "Scam" consistent with "all of the others" represents ongoing reality distortion and gaslighting, building a serial persecution narrative that delegitimizes institutional oversight. The circular logic—public support proves persecution, persecution generates public support—creates a self-reinforcing validation loop characteristic of epistemic closure dynamics.

Fact Checks (2)
"Received strongest poll numbers ever"
Unverifiable

Vague claim with no specific poll cited. Some polls did show increased Republican support after the search, but 'strongest ever' is unsubstantiated.

"Largest amount of campaign contributions from the people"
Mostly True

Reports indicated Trump's Save America PAC saw a significant fundraising surge following the Mar-a-Lago search, though 'largest ever' is likely hyperbolic.
